For a 50kW grid-tied solar system, total project ranges usually fall between $70,000 and $140,000, depending on equipment and site factors. Typical systems use poly or monocrystalline modules, string inverters, and standard racking. Most homeowners spend between $12,600 and $33,376 to install a complete residential solar system in 2026, with the national average at $19,873 before incentives. This typically translates to about $2. 50 per watt of installed capacity (more on price per watt below). Let's start with the solar panels.

Although both handle power conversion, their functions, applications, and roles within the. . What manages the flow of energy between the grid and storage batteries in an energy storage system? The Power Conversion System (PCS) plays a key role in efficiently converting and regulating the flow of energy between the grid and storage batteries.
